Students who successfully complete this course will be able to:

  • Apply the basic concepts of usability engineering and interaction design
  • Design and evaluate user interfaces
  • Evaluate applications and make informed recommendations for improvement
  • Use heuristics or user-centred methods to evaluate systems
  • Gather and review user requirements
  • Measure user experience in controlled environments and in the real world
  • Consider accessibility in the design and implementation of applications
  • Understand human cognitive and physical capabilities and limitations

This course covers the following topics

  • The origins, history and fundamentals of usability engineering and interaction design
  • The fundamentals of human perception and cognition, and machine form factors and capabilities as a starting point for ubiquitous computing
  • Design principles, key concepts and methods for usability engineering and interaction design
  • Approaches, methods and critical reflection on user testing and evaluation
  • Accessibility and Ethical Software Engineering

Allocation of places in courses with a limited number of participants (PS, SE, VU, PJ)

In courses with a limited number of participants, course places are allocated as follows:

1. Students for whom the study duration would be extended due to the postponement are to be given priority.

2. If criterion no. 1 does not suffice for regulating the admission, then first, students for whom the course is part of a compulsory module are to be given priority, and second, students for whom the course is part of an elective module.

3. If the criteria in no. 1 and 2 do not suffice for regulating the admission, then the available places are raffled.
